It takes an average of 5 hours 48 minutes to travel from Salisbury to Newmarket by train. You'll find on average 9 trains per day running on this route.
There aren't any direct services on this line, but it's still easy to travel to Newmarket by train; you'll need to make 3 changes.
Trains on this route are operated by Great Western Railway, Greater Anglia, South Western Railway and Southeastern.
The journey from Salisbury to Newmarket starts at £73.10. Generally, booking Advance train tickets works out cheaper.
